If I could be whatever I wanted to be

I would heal the sick and set them free.

I would care for them until they are not in need

Of me to love and to care and to feed.

 

If I could be whatever I wanted to be

I would cure every terrible disease.

I would make sure that none ever have to see

Any trace of it and always be pleased.

 

If I could be whatever I wanted to be  

I would be a doctor that only receives

Pay from all the smiles that she brings

And all the times she brings a “yippee!”

 

If I could be whatever I wanted to be

I would want patients to be happy to see me

I would make sure that no one would ever have to plea

For cleansing from any infirmity. I hope you agree.
